Psychologists call the effects of this social comparison. When people constantly compare themselves to others’ highlight reels, it can damage self-esteem and mental well-being.
By staying more private, some individuals avoid falling into that comparison cycle.
For them, protecting their peace is more important than maintaining an online image.
